Rachel Mary Ann Beck 1872–1923 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: Apr 1872

Birth Location: Bradeston, Norfolk

Death Date: Sep 1923

Death Location: Henstead, Norfolk

Father: James Beck

Mother: Harriet Overman

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1872, Rachel Mary Ann Beck entered the world in Bradeston, Norfolk, born to James Arthur Beck And Harriet Eliza Overman. In 1881, Rachel Mary Ann Beck resided in Pit House, Bradestone, Norfolk. Rachel Mary Ann Beck passed away in 1923 in Henstead, Norfolk.
